Read MoreThe Dunkermotoren RE56 and RE56TI are high-resolution incremental encoders that deliver quadrature position and speed feedback for closed-loop motion control. With up to 2,000 pulses per channel and 8,000 counts per revolution, they give control systems the resolution needed to hold precise shaft positions, detect direction of rotation, and maintain smooth velocity at low speeds — tasks where lower-resolution encoders fall short.
Both encoders mount directly to Dunkermotoren brushless DC and geared motors, sharing the motor housing without additional brackets or couplings. The RE56TI variant adds complementary differential outputs (/A, /B, /I) for noise-immune signal transmission — the recommended choice for cable runs beyond 2.5 m between encoder and controller, or installations in electrically noisy environments.
Typical applications include robotics and collaborative automation, conveyor and material handling systems, pump and valve control, and precision positioning in industrial machinery. The standard RE56 is rated to −40°C to +100°C, making it suitable for cold-store and process environments without a specialist build.
The RE 56 series is designed for use with the Dunkermotoren GR42, GR53, GR 63, and GR 80 geared motor series and the BG62 dCore, BG65 dCore, and BG75 dCore brushless EC motors.
Show LessFeatures
- Up to 2,000 ppr (8,000 counts per revolution) resolves finer shaft movement, supporting tighter positioning and smoother running at low speed
- Index pulse gives a once-per-revolution zero reference, so the axis re-establishes a repeatable datum without an external home switch
- TI line-driver version sends complementary signals (/A, /B, /I) that stay readable through electrical noise on runs beyond 2.5 m
- Contact-free sensing leaves no brushes or wear surfaces to service on high-cycle axes
- Standard RE 56 rated −40°C to +100°C, so cold stores and hot process areas are covered without a special build
- Two resolution options in one part series let you standardise across axes with different precision requirements
Specifications
| Data | RE 56 | RE 56 TI |
|---|---|---|
| Nominal voltage | 5 Vdc | 5 Vdc |
| Pulses per channel and revolution | 1,000/2,000 | 1,000/2,000 |
| Counts per revolution | 4,000/8,000 | 4,000/8,000 |
| Interface | A/B/I | A/B/I |
| Rise time | 180 ns | 20 ns |
| Fall time | 49 ns | 20 ns |
| Input current | 85 mA | 165 mA |
| Output voltage (low-max.) | 0.4 Vdc | 0.5 Vdc |
| Output voltage (high-min.) | 2.4 Vdc | 2.5 Vdc |
| Output current max. | 5 mA | 20 mA |
| Operating temperature | −40°C to +100°C | 0°C to +70°C |
| Protection class | IP 30 | IP 30 |
